Three soldiers were killed in clashes with PKK terrorists in southeastern Mardin province on Thursday.
According to the Anadolu Agency, security forces killed seven PKK terrorists during clashes, which took place in Dargeçit district of Mardin province.
The operation is still underway.
Turkey's southeast has been the scene of significant military operations since December against the PKK-designated as a terrorist organization by Turkey, the U.S., and the EU-which renewed its terrorist campaign against the Turkish state in July 2015.
Since then, more than 280 security forces personnel and thousands of PKK terrorists have been killed in operations across Turkey and northern Iraq.
